Addictedtocruising Posted April 21, 2009 #1 Share Posted April 21, 2009 Hi, I'm looking for suggestions on where to stay 1 day post cruise in September 2009 that is out of the way of the hustle and bustle. When I get off the ship I would like to grab a taxi or rent a car and get out of dodge :D Our flight home is not until 2:40 pm on the next Monday, would you suggest we stay close to the airport or maybe half way? I would need a hotel that is at least within walking distance to a restaurant and maybe a liquor store since we may be using a taxi to get there. Or better yet is there a convenient way to get a shuttle to a rental car when I get off the ship and then drop it off at the airport the next day? Just take a cab after you disembark and then cab it to SJU when you leave. It is in the Condado district, which is very nice and not far from the pier. Recently totally remodeled and very reasonably priced. They have a great pool area w/a swim up bar. Check it out on line. We stayed there in '07 during the remodel and it was nice then.
